Black Drum Pogonias cromis Broad black vertical bars along body.

Barbells on chin.

Spotted Seatrout (Winter trout, speckled trout) Cynoscion nebulosus

Numerous distinct black spots on dorsal surface.

Most commonly encountered in rivers and estuaries.
